How AI Is Transforming Digital Marketing in 2026
Artificial Intelligence (AI) is no longer a futuristic concept—it has become a core part of digital marketing. In 2026, businesses of all sizes are using AI to improve customer experiences, automate repetitive tasks, create high-quality content, and make smarter marketing decisions. What once required hours of manual effort can now be completed in minutes with the help of AI-powered tools.
However, AI is not replacing digital marketers. Instead, it is helping them work faster, more efficiently, and more strategically. Marketers who understand how to combine AI with creativity and human insight are gaining a significant competitive advantage.
The Rise of AI in Digital Marketing
Over the past few years, AI technology has evolved rapidly. Modern AI tools can analyze customer behavior, predict future trends, generate content, personalize marketing campaigns, and optimize advertising performance in real time.
Businesses are adopting AI because consumers expect faster responses, personalized experiences, and relevant recommendations. AI enables companies to meet these expectations while reducing costs and improving productivity.
AI-Powered Content Creation
Content remains one of the most important aspects of digital marketing. In 2026, AI assists marketers in creating:
- Blog articles
- Social media captions
- Email newsletters
- Product descriptions
- Video scripts
- Ad copy
- SEO content
AI can quickly generate drafts, suggest headlines, improve grammar, and optimize content for search engines. This significantly reduces the time spent on writing while allowing marketers to focus on creativity, storytelling, and brand messaging.
It’s important to remember that AI-generated content performs best when reviewed and refined by humans. Authenticity, originality, and emotional connection still require human creativity.
Personalized Customer Experiences
Personalization has become a necessity rather than a luxury. AI analyzes customer data such as browsing history, purchasing behavior, demographics, and interests to deliver highly personalized experiences.
Examples include:
- Personalized product recommendations
- Dynamic website content
- Customized email campaigns
- Individualized advertisements
- Tailored landing pages
Instead of showing every visitor the same message, AI helps businesses present content that matches each person’s interests, increasing engagement and conversion rates.
Smarter SEO Strategies
Search Engine Optimization (SEO) has become more intelligent with AI.
Modern AI tools help marketers:
- Discover high-performing keywords
- Analyze competitors
- Optimize website structure
- Improve readability
- Generate SEO-friendly titles
- Create optimized meta descriptions
- Identify content gaps
- Monitor ranking performance
AI also helps marketers understand search intent rather than focusing only on keywords. Creating valuable, user-focused content remains the key to long-term SEO success.
AI in Social Media Marketing
Managing multiple social media platforms can be time-consuming. AI simplifies the process by helping marketers:
- Generate engaging captions
- Schedule posts automatically
- Recommend the best posting times
- Analyze audience engagement
- Identify trending topics
- Create hashtags
- Monitor brand mentions
AI analytics also provide valuable insights into what type of content performs best, allowing marketers to improve their social media strategies continuously.
AI-Powered Email Marketing
Email marketing remains one of the highest ROI digital marketing channels, and AI has made it even more effective.
AI can:
- Segment audiences automatically
- Personalize email content
- Predict the best sending time
- Improve subject lines
- Reduce unsubscribe rates
- Increase open rates
- Optimize click-through rates
Rather than sending identical emails to every subscriber, businesses can now deliver highly relevant messages to different customer segments.
Better Advertising with AI
Digital advertising platforms now rely heavily on AI.
AI helps optimize:
- Google Ads
- Facebook Ads
- Instagram Ads
- LinkedIn Ads
- YouTube Ads
It continuously analyzes campaign performance and automatically adjusts bidding strategies, audience targeting, budgets, and placements to maximize return on investment (ROI).
This allows businesses to spend advertising budgets more efficiently while achieving better results.
AI Chatbots and Customer Support
Customers expect immediate responses when visiting a website. AI-powered chatbots provide instant assistance 24/7.
Modern chatbots can:
- Answer frequently asked questions
- Recommend products
- Collect customer information
- Schedule appointments
- Process simple orders
- Guide visitors through websites
While complex customer issues still require human support, AI significantly improves response times and customer satisfaction.
Predictive Analytics
One of AI’s greatest strengths is its ability to predict future customer behavior.
Using historical data, AI can forecast:
- Customer purchases
- Market trends
- Seasonal demand
- Churn probability
- Campaign performance
- Product demand
These insights help businesses make data-driven marketing decisions rather than relying solely on assumptions.
Marketing Automation
Marketing automation has become far more powerful with AI.
Businesses can automate:
- Lead nurturing
- Email sequences
- CRM updates
- Social media publishing
- Customer follow-ups
- Report generation
- Campaign monitoring
Automation reduces repetitive work and allows marketers to focus on strategy, creativity, and business growth.
Challenges of Using AI
Although AI offers many benefits, it also presents several challenges.
Businesses should consider:
- Protecting customer privacy
- Ensuring data security
- Avoiding biased AI outputs
- Maintaining brand authenticity
- Reviewing AI-generated content for accuracy
AI should be viewed as a tool that supports human expertise—not as a complete replacement for skilled marketers.
The Human Touch Still Matters
Despite AI’s impressive capabilities, successful marketing continues to depend on human creativity, empathy, and strategic thinking.
Customers connect with authentic stories, emotional messaging, and trustworthy brands. AI can assist in creating and optimizing content, but building lasting customer relationships still requires a human approach.
The most successful marketers in 2026 are those who use AI to enhance their skills rather than replace them.
